Day.js is a lightweight alternative to the now deprecated date and time handling library, Moment.js. It is written in JavaScript and uses a similar API to Moment.js. Day.js is sufficient for date operations such as parsing, manipulation, and display. It is designed for use on both the browser and the Node.js runtime. - Source: dev.to / about 2 months ago
Similar API to Moment.js: Day.js provides a familiar API, making it easier for developers previously using Moment.js to transition. - Source: dev.to / about 2 months ago

A VDOM library like Inferno uses this information to compile its JSX directly into pre-optimized node structures. Marko, and Vue hoist their static VDOM nodes outside of their components so that they don't incur the overhead of recreating them on every render. - Source: dev.to / about 3 years ago
